1 May 2018 Dear friends, What s in a name? We all know names are important. Names are the way we are idenfied. When my mom called out my name, I knew she was looking for me and not one of my brothers or my sister. We can be defined by our name and somemes names carry great symbolism. That was o"en the case with the names given in the Bible, and especially when people are re-named in the Bible. For example, God gave the name Abraham, an extension of the shorter, Abram, which means father of many. God, indeed, made a promise to Abraham that his descendants would be as the stars of heaven and as the sand that is on the seashore. (Gen. 22:17) And God made good on that promise and it all began with the birth in Abraham s old age of his son, Isaac. Jacob s name means, to grasp the heel. Do you remember the story of his birth in Genesis 25? Go back and take a look. Through his life, he was a bit of a deceiver, seeking to grab that which was not righ4ully his, which is what it meant to grasp the heel. But a day came when God changed his name to Israel which means, to strive with God. (Gen. 32:28) That name change was the result of Jacob asking for and then receiving a blessing. He was a different person from that day on. In the New Testament we find a fisherman named, Simon, who is renamed by Jesus. (Ma;. 16:18) I tell you, you are Peter, and on this rock I will build my church and the gates of hell shall not prevail against it. In Greek, Peter (Petros) means rock, and his confession of Jesus as Lord was solid as a rock. And then, there was a persecutor of the church named Saul who had a life changing encounter with the living Christ as he was walking on the road to Damascus. His life was transformed and he went from being a persecutor of the church to an evangelist to the Genles. He transions from the Hebrew, Saul, to the Greek name, Paul, which seemed to be a symbol of the change in his life and a change in his mission in life.
